## About Metabase
Metabase is the easy-to-use, open source Business Intelligence tool that lets everyone work with data, with or without SQL, for internal and customer-facing, embedded analytics. Install and setup in 5 minutes. Works with what’s already in your data stack, including SQL and NoSQL databases, from PostgreSQL to MongoDB. Let your whole team explore data on their own, create charts, interactive dashboards, and set up subscriptions and alerts - even to people outside of your org. The native SQL editor and advanced data tools will win over your data team.   ### 1. Best free data analytics tool

**Rating:** 5.0/5.0 stars

**Reviewed by:** Igor R. | CTO, Small-Business (50 or fewer emp.)

**Reviewed Date:** July 10, 2021

**What do you like best about Metabase?**

The best part of Metabase is that it works well for people who never tried anything related to analytics, but also for people well versed in SQL. As a CTO, I was able to teach my marketing and sales team how to make their own queries, but I still can quickly write pure SQL queries when a more complex analysis is needed. Another great part is the embedding system. We were able to save a lot of development time by incorporating Metabase's graphs in our product, and the integration was very easy.

**What do you dislike about Metabase?**

Dark-mode would be a game-changer. They could also improve the x-rays feature, which rarely shows relevant analysis. I have never found a useful pre-made query there, so I just ignore this feature for the most part.

**What problems is Metabase solving and how is that benefiting you?**

We use Metabase for two things: understanding how users behave in our product, as sort of a product analytics tool, and also as a third-party analytics provider, by embedding Metabase's graphs in our system to show users how their teams are performing. As an analytics tool, it has helped us quickly build a dashboard that makes the information accessible and transparent for stakeholders such as the sales and marketing team. As third-party analytics, it has saved us tons of development effort, since we didn't have to develop our graphs on the application's front-end.

  ### 10. Metabase - Less robust BI tool but Self-serve quick analytics for your analytics team

**Rating:** 3.0/5.0 stars

**Reviewed by:** Verified User in Government Administration | Small-Business (50 or fewer emp.)

**Reviewed Date:** August 27, 2021

**What do you like best about Metabase?**

I like that Metabase is relatively quick and easy to use if the reporting layer is set up correctly to use the self-serve options available.   If reporting layer isn't set up correctly with views that accomplish both fact and dimensional qualities, then it won't be easy to scale as you will be stuck using the custom SQL queries for every card you make.

**What do you dislike about Metabase?**

Filtering and dates can sometimes be confusing if you are doing custom SQL queries due to the custom queries' variable attributes.  Visualization customization is also minimal; with only nine colors to choose from, it has that open-source feel.  Very basic dashboards with snap to the grid that gives a very boxy appeal.  

If you are wanting a more robust BI tool, this might not be for you.

**Recommendations to others considering Metabase:**

Metabase is great if you want a self-serve option for quick and dirty analytics across the board.  However, it falls short when you are looking for more robust insights.  Again, the self-serve option really only works if the reporting layer is set-up properly so that the need for custom sql queries becomes lower.  Metabase is also very limited in visualization customization and designing dashboards.

**What problems is Metabase solving and how is that benefiting you?**

To streamline across the analysts in making the self-serve option available so anyone can go in and analyze without writing large queries.

  ### 22. Open source, super powerful data visualisation tool

**Rating:** 5.0/5.0 stars

**Reviewed by:** Aleksei A. | Head Of Analytics, Mid-Market (51-1000 emp.)

**Reviewed Date:** December 08, 2020

**What do you like best about Metabase?**

It is free. Functionality is very powerful, supports almost all data sources you would like to connect to it. Bugs are getting fixed quickly, a lot of updates with new functionality. Really love their answers section.

**What do you dislike about Metabase?**

Canvas for dashboards is limited. Can't blend data coming from different data sources. In case if data is stored in a different database you first need to pre-process it in some sort of DWH before getting connected to Metabase.

**What problems is Metabase solving and how is that benefiting you?**

The "Answers" feature is super nice allowing users to create and store data queries "answering" some specific questions. You can also re-use saved answers in dashboards later.
Alert to Slack is also very helpful. Allowing you immediately (once an hour) to get an update once there is a potential problem with data.

  ### 31. Powerful Usability but LOW computing power

**Rating:** 3.5/5.0 stars

**Reviewed by:** Verified User in Information Technology and Services | Mid-Market (51-1000 emp.)

**Reviewed Date:** June 29, 2020

**What do you like best about Metabase?**

It is super easy to share with team members both on queries and also findings in real-time. It came super handy to check live stats with the whole organization and empower non-data folks. It also offers cool visualizations options to show results, which can serve as a nice reporting function. The Dashboard organization functionality is also helpful to keep things organized.

**What do you dislike about Metabase?**

The LOW computing power. For large/complicated queries, sometimes it will never come back. The most annoying part is that the message on screen is 'Doing Science', while that screen could run in HOURS and then popped up an error message. This part is a huge limitation to its usage. 
Also, the query writing/drafting isn't good - it can't fold subquery or highlight indexing like other tools.

**What problems is Metabase solving and how is that benefiting you?**

BI reporting, Data Enablement.
Team collaborations, Visualizations

  ### 38. Excellent open source BI tool which works across multiple DBs

**Rating:** 4.5/5.0 stars

**Reviewed by:** Jaideep T. | Senior Vice President and Head of Product &amp; Technology, Small-Business (50 or fewer emp.)

**Reviewed Date:** December 14, 2018

**What do you like best about Metabase?**

Metabase is easy to setup in your own local environment as well as cloud space.  It has a very intuitive interface to setup queries, as well as a DIY interface for writing your own SQL queries.  Additionally, the user based security feature really helps in segregating data between users.  Data can be easily downloaded to csv, xlsx or pdf.  Pulses (or email alerts) really help keeping up with changes in data. 

**What do you dislike about Metabase?**

Being java based, metabase can be a bit resource hungry, especially when complex queries are run.  As of this writing, it does not parse json fields.  Also an auto generated database map would be helpful. 

**Recommendations to others considering Metabase:**

Great BI tool.  Quick and easy setup.  Best for those who care more about getting data efficiently than those who want a high end product (like Qlikview) for their analysis.  Do remember that if you host metabase on the cloud, there is a cost to keep the cloud server running!

**What problems is Metabase solving and how is that benefiting you?**

Quering transactional data on our system without requiring developers to write code.  Sharing data with operations team for them to do their own pivots and analysis.
